For IP and IPv6 rate-limit profiles:
[ no ] conformed-action { drop | transmit | mark markVal }
For L2TP rate-limit profiles:
[ no ] conformed-action { drop | transmit }
For MPLS rate-limit profiles:
[ no ] conformed-action { drop | transmit | mark-exp expValue }
For hierarchical rate-limit profiles:
[ no ] conformed-action { drop | transmit [ conditional | unconditional | final ] }
Command introduced before JunosE Release 7.1.0.
Sets the action for packets not conforming to the committed rate and committed burst
size, but conforming to the peak rate and peak burst size for a rate-limit profile. The no
version restores the value to the default value, drop.
drop—Drops the packet
transmit—Transmits the packet; for hierarchical rate limits:
conditional—Packets must pass the next rate limit
unconditional—Packets take resources, but are not affected by the rest of the
hierarchy
final—Packets exit the hierarchy at rate limit
markVal—Value in the range 0–255
expValue—EXP bit value in the range 0–7
